How has the closure of USAID impacted health, climate, and development programs in India

Analyze the potential setbacks expected in health, climate, and development initiatives in India following the closure of USAID, as warned by experts.
  • Health Programs: The closure of USAID could lead to a reduction in funding for crucial health programs in India, impacting initiatives such as maternal and child health, disease prevention, and healthcare infrastructure development.
  • Climate Programs: USAID plays a significant role in supporting climate change projects in India, and without its funding, efforts to address environmental challenges, promote renewable energy, and enhance climate resilience may suffer setbacks.
  • Development Programs: The closure of USAID could result in a decline in support for key development projects in areas such as education, agriculture, and economic empowerment, potentially slowing down progress in these sectors.
Experts warn that the absence of USAID's assistance could hinder India's efforts to address pressing health, climate, and development issues, leading to negative impacts on the country's overall well-being and sustainable growth.
